Transaction 65158e768c45b2ee4679dc7f4b86227f47094d26ab05490e2f92026f0cc20e17
1 Input
2 Outputs
- 65158e768c45b2ee4679dc7f4b86227f47094d26ab05490e2f92026f0cc20e17:0
- 65158e768c45b2ee4679dc7f4b86227f47094d26ab05490e2f92026f0cc20e17:1
value 7364160
address 3Qnqa1aak4dt4ZwiHVEMNF5ks5DpyEfEF1
value 8405655
address 13ySexLkpsuLRa3UpFATCWxC6tbEHQF95N